Full description

Savernake Species Demonstration Site: To demonstrate the impact of lucerne seeding rate and variety on pasture persistence and quality.
Barooga Grazing Demonstration Site: To demonstrate the benefits of rotationally grazing lucerne for improving pasture persistence, pasture quality and animal production.
